Subject: Scalewise 2.4 ready for release channel

Hi all — welcome aboard to our new contractor as well. Scalewise 2.4, the recipe-scaling calculator, is staged for Thursday's release. Changes: fractional-unit rounding fixes, metric/imperial toggle persistence, and the long-requested batch multiplier cap raise. QA signed off Monday; no open blockers. Contractors, please review the scaling-edge-cases doc before touching the rounding module. Artifacts are in the usual staging bucket. The candidate build is identified by the token below.

session token of tajef-bageg = htk21_5d90d574934f3ccae6437

To the heads of department: as I hand responsibilities to Director Pell, please note the Branwick unit divestment is at the diligence stage with the prospective buyer, Halvane Group. Data-room access is restricted to the deal team; keep staff communications to the approved script. Customer contracts with change-of-control clauses have been flagged and require sequenced notification. Pell will chair the weekly deal call from Monday. The confidential note below sets out the associated business plans.

management briefing: Headcount on the Holdor team goes from 20 to 123 by the end of June. Gross margin on Holdor came in at 13 percent against a plan of 32 percent.

Ticket: Staging env misconfigured for Siftgate bloom filter

The bloom layer in front of the Pellet KV store is rejecting all lookups in staging because the env file was copied from the dev template without credentials. False-positive tuning values are fine; only the auth line is missing. To unblock the weekly demo, the Pellet admission secret must be set on the following line.

env line for yaguf-fajop: LEDGER_TOKEN13=fb08984397349